Abstract

This article believes church polity is critically important, especially in recent times where an appeal is quite easily made to the courts of the political dispensation. The article believes the scriptural viewpoint that Jesus Christ is head of the church plays a substantial role in the modern-day church, which should be kept in mind regardless. Reference is made to court cases in the past and the conclusion is that church polity is relevant because it is a scriptural necessity.
